You can, but there's many many steps you'd need to take to do so. You would have to hide ALL electrical wires and such, block access to getting behind or under dangerous things- like refrigerators, dryer, etc. You would have to be sure that any other pets you have would not harm it, OR play too rough with it. You would have to clean up after it. It's not recommended. You'd have to make sure it didn't pee or poop in its water dish- this is why bottles are better. You could accidentally crush it if it slept with you and you moved.. It's not a good idea.
